micro-ROS Demos

License

Overview

The primary purpose for this repository is to organise all packages for the Micro-ROS project functionalities demonstrations. All packages contained in this repository are a part of the Micro-ROS project stack.

Simple message demonstration

Packages

Int32_publisher

The purpose of the package is to publish one of the most basic ROS2 messages and demonstrate how Micro-ROS layers (rcl, typesupport and rmw) handle it. For each publication, the message value increases in one unit order to see in the subscriber side the message variations.

Int32_subscriber

The purpose of the package is to subscribe to one of the most basic ROS2 messages and demonstrate how Micro-ROS layers (rcl, typesupport and rmw) handle it.

Run demonstration (Linux)

Run the micro-ROS Agent. For the micro-ROS Agent to find the XML reference file, the execution must be done from the executable folder.

cd ~/agent_ws/install/uros_agent/lib/uros_agent/
./uros_agent udp 8888

You may prefer to run the Agent in the background and discard all outputs to keep using the same terminal for the next step.

cd ~/agent_ws/install/uros_agent/lib/uros_agent/
./uros_agent udp 8888 > /dev/null &

Run the publisher.

~/client_ws/install/int32_publisher_c/lib/int32_publisher_c/./int32_publisher_c

You may prefer to run the publisher in the background and discard all outputs to keep using the terminal for the next step.

 ~/client_ws/install/int32_publisher_c/lib/int32_publisher_c/./int32_publisher_c > /dev/null &

Run the subscriber.

~/client_ws/install/int32_subscriber_c/lib/int32_subscriber_c/./int32_subscriber_c

Complex message demonstration

Complex packages

complex_msg

One of the purposes of the package is to demonstrate how typesupport code is generated for a complex message. Also, the generation of a complex ROS2 structure message is used to demonstrate how the different layers (rcl, typesupport and rmw) handle it. The message structure contains the following types:

  • All primitive data types.
  • Nested message data.
  • Unbonded string data.
Complex_msg_publisher

The purpose of the package is to publish a complex ROS2 message and demonstrate how Micro-ROS layers (rcl, typesupport and rmw) handle it. For each publication, the message values increases in one unit order to see in the subscriber side the message variations.

Complex_msg_subscriber

The purpose of the package is to subscribe to a complex ROS2 message and demonstrate how Micro-ROS layers (rcl, typesupport and rmw) handle it.

Real application demonstration

This purpose of the packages is to demonstrate Micro-ROS stack can be used in a real application scenario. In this demonstration, an altitude control system is simulated. The primary purpose of this is to demonstrate how Micro-ROS communicates with ROS2 nodes.

Real application packages

rad0_actuator

The mission of this node is to simulate a dummy engine power actuator. It receives power increments and publishes the total power amount as a DDS topic.

The node is built using the Micro-ROS middleware packages (rmw_micro_xrcedds and rosidl_typesupport_microxrcedds).

It is meant to be running in a microcontroller processor, but for this demonstration, the node runs on the host PC. The node is connected to the DDS world through a Micro XRCE-DDS Agent.

rad0_altitude_sensor

The mission of this node is to simulate a dummy altitude sensor. It publishes the altitude variations as a DDS topic.

The node is built using the Micro-ROS middleware packages (rmw_micro_xrcedds and rosidl_typesupport_microxrcedds).

It is meant to be running in a microcontroller processor, but for this demonstration, the node runs on the host PC. The node is connected to the DDS world through a Micro XRCE-DDS Agent.

rad0_control

The mission of this node is to read altitude values and send to the actuator engine variations. It also publishes the status (OK, WARNING or FAILURE) as a DDS topic. The status depends on the altitude value.

The node is built using the ROS2 middleware packages (rmw_fastrtps and rosidl_typesupport_fastrtps).

It is meant to be running in on a regular PC, and it is directly connected to de DDS world.

rad0_display

The mission of this node is to simulate one LCD screen that prints the critical parameters. It subscribes to the altitude, power and status messages available as a DDS topic.

The node is built using the Micro-ROS middleware packages (rmw_micro_xrcedds and rosidl_typesupport_microxrcedds).

It is meant to be running in a microcontroller processor, but for this demonstration, the node runs on the host PC. The node is connected to the DDS world through a Micro XRCE-DDS Agent.

Purpose of the Project

This software is not ready for production use. It has neither been developed nor tested for a specific use case. However, the license conditions of the applicable Open Source licenses allow you to adapt the software to your needs. Before using it in a safety relevant setting, make sure that the software fulfills your requirements and adjust it according to any applicable safety standards, e.g., ISO 26262.
